    Please use care when contracting a guide for an "exteme tour." Few guides will even bring basic first aide equipment such as snake anti-venom. There is an excellent snake anti-venom (suero antiofidico) made by Probiol that is effective against most poisonous snakes found in the Amazon. Recently a tourist went missing and his body was found a month later. The coroner listed death as due to a snakebite. Be safe and be smart. Refuse to partake in an expedition unless the guide provides a basic first kit containing snake anti-venom.
